"The Church rests on the grace of God, the judging, atoning, regenerating grace of God which is his holy love in the form it must take within human sin. Wherever that is heartily confessed and goes on to rule we have the true Church." P. T. Forsyth Do evangelicals have a clear and strong doctrine of the church? Can we generate one? Fourteen scholars and teachers explore in this volume the history of evangelical ecclesiology and the continuing discussion regarding the nature of the church, show more the question of sacraments, the relation of church to society, its moral character and missional witness. show lessTags

Daniel J. Treier (PhD, Trinity Evangelical Divinity School) is Knoedler Professor of Theology at Wheaton College Graduate School. He is the author of Introducing Theological interpretation of Scripture and the coeditor of several books, including the Evangelical Dictionary of Theology and the award-winning Dictionary for Theological interpretation show more of the Bible. show less
